Predictive Temperature Monitoring¶
Purpose¶
This Data Point Subtopic represents all of the temperature monitoring group data points that are being sent over the databus. In order to subscribe to these data points, the subscription will need the temperature Metering category subtopic at the beginning of the topic string, "48".
For example, if an application needs temperature monitoring group data across various applications, they would subscribe to the "48/#" category. If they want to get a specific data point from the category, they would first need to subscribe to the category subtopic, then the data point subtopic (ex. "CAT/DP/#" or "48/31/#" for the Phase_1_Delta_Temperature data point).

Config Event¶
This is breakdown of the config device event. This will be a retained message on the databus and can be subscribed to by using the following topic: 48/0/50
Subpoint Name | Subpoint Type | Unit | Notes |
---|---|---|---|
Electrical_Metering_Device_Name | string | NA | |
Electrical_Metering_Device_Source | string | NA | |
Temperature_Sensor_Name_Phase_1 | string | NA | |
Temperature_Sensor_Source_Phase_1 | string | NA | |
Temperature_Sensor_Name_Phase_2 | string | NA | |
Temperature_Sensor_Source_Phase_2 | string | NA | |
Temperature_Sensor_Name_Phase_3 | string | NA | |
Temperature_Sensor_Source_Phase_3 | string | NA | |
Temperature_Sensor_Name_Ambient | string | NA | |
Temperature_Sensor_Source_Ambient | string | NA | |
Sensor_Location | string | NA | The location type of the electrical conduit of where the temperature sensors are attached to. |
Group_Load_Rating | double | Amps | The load rating of the electrical conduit or the load rating of the electrical breaker. |
Electrical_Operational_Setpoint | double | Amps | Customer/User-defined setpoint for the actual expected load running through the conduit. |
Electrical_Warning_Setpoint | double | Amps | Customer/User-defined setpoint for the warning threshold of the load. |
Electrical_Alarm_Setpoint | double | Amps | Customer/User-defined setpoint for the alarm threshold of the load. |
Lineup_Name | string | NA | Comes from topic: x/x/x/x/x from a smartgear electrical device. Can sometimes be null or NA. |
Baseline_Status | string | NA | Expected Values: "Not Started", "Starting", "In Progress", "Completed". |
Baseline_Completion_Date | timestamp | YYYY-MM-DDThh | Completion Date of the 7 day baseline of a group. Can sometimes be null or NA. |
Equipment_Type | string | "Switchgear" or Switchboard | Type for IEEE calculation |
